Two arrested after burglary in Central Point
CENTRAL POINT, Ore. -- Two people have been arrested after allegedly committing a burglary yesterday morning in Central Point. According to a Facebook post from the Jackson County Sheriff's Office, it started when police heard about a burglary in the 5700 block of Upton Road. They were able to find the suspects -- 44-year-old Kelli Margaret Hernandez of Medford and 28-year-old Mickey Ray Galatz of Central Point -- later.

Medford approves nearly $1 million in funding for stormwater treatment
MEDFORD, Ore. – Medford is moving forward with a project to improve the quality of stormwater runoff going into a portion of Bear Creek. Medford City Council approved a contract with MC Carlton Contracting, Inc. during last Thursday’s meeting to put $949,350 towards the project. The funding is going towards relocating the existing storm drain on N Riverside Ave. and installing a regional stormwater facility in the Liberty Park neighborhood.
